Plasticity and geomechanics /
Plasticity and Geomechanics presents a concise introduction to the general subject of plasticity with a particular emphasis on applications in geomechanics. Derived from the authors' own lecture notes, this book will appeal to graduate students and researchers in the fields of soil mechanics, g...
